How to Cold Email a Recruiter: A Step by Step Guide In this guide, you'll learn how to effectively cold email recruiters to expand your job search. Reaching out proactively can set you apart from other candidates, making your application stand out.

Follow these steps to craft a compelling email that invites responses. What You Need Before You Start A clear understanding of your career goals and desired roles A professional email address A well crafted resume and/or LinkedIn profile Research on the recruiter and their agency A template for your cold email (we’ll provide one!) Step 1: Research the Recruiter Before you send your email, take some time to research the recruiter.

Look for their LinkedIn profile or the agency’s website to learn about their specialties and the industries they work with. This knowledge will help you tailor your message and demonstrate genuine interest. Step 2: Choose the Right Subject Line The subject line is your first impression, so make it count.

Keep it concise and relevant. A good example might be: “Aspiring [Job Title] Seeking Opportunities.” This clearly indicates your intent and catches the recruiter's attention. Step 3: Start with a Friendly Greeting Open your email with a warm greeting.
